Graph a parabola whose vertex is at (3,5)(3,5)left parenthesis, 3, comma, 5, right parenthesis with yyy-intercept at y=1y=1y, eq
Rudik [331]

Using the given information we found that the equation of the parabola is:

y = (-4/9)*(x - 3)^2 + 5

And its graph is below.

<h3>How to get the equation of the parabola?</h3>

For a parabola with vertex (h, k), the equation is:

y = a*(x - h)^2 + k

Here the vertex is (3, 5), so the equation is:

y = a*(x - 3)^2 + 5

And the y-intercept is y = 1, this means that:

1 = a*(0 - 3)^2 + 5

1 = a*9 + 5

1 - 5 = a*9

-4/9 = a

So the parabola is:

y = (-4/9)*(x - 3)^2 + 5

And its graph is below.
